Capsicum annuum (Pequin)
Small wild-type Mexican chili. Smoky citrus flavour. Common dried table condiment in Mexico. SHU 40,000–60,000.

Start Pequin indoors about 12 weeks before your last frost, keeping seeds in warm soil (around 20–25 °C). Seeds usually come up in around 21 days. Move seedlings out once the danger of frost has passed, in full sun, spaced about 45 cm apart. Expect to harvest in roughly 100 days.
Water: Medium · Height: 90 cm · Soil: Rich, well-draining, warm (pH 5.5–6.8)
